Andrew Huberman's Morning Light Exposure Protocol
Andrew Huberman, a neuroscientist at Stanford University, emphasizes morning light exposure as a cornerstone of science-backed protocols to optimize your biology. This practice involves 10 to 30 minutes of viewing low solar angle sunlight shortly after waking, ideally within the first hour. The light signals the suprachiasmatic nucleus in the brain to advance the circadian clock, promoting healthy cortisol rhythms and evening melatonin onset.
Research supports these fundamentals: studies in chronobiology show that morning light suppresses melatonin during the day while enhancing its production at night, leading to improved sleep quality and daytime alertness. Huberman recommends facing toward the sun with eyes open but protected by sunglasses only if intensity requires it - never staring directly. Cloud cover reduces effectiveness, so seek brighter conditions when possible.
Consistency matters most. Perform this daily to entrain your internal clock, especially during seasonal changes when light patterns shift. Pair it with hydration and delayed caffeine to amplify effects on focus and vitality.
